High-Twist Linen Architecture relies on tightly spun flax yarns that create microscopic tension within each thread. High-twist linen drapes more cleanly than standard flat-weave linen because the tight yarn twist resists permanent crease deformation while circulating airflow.
Silk-Rayon Blends and Kinetic Fluidity offer unmatched movement for camp collar shirts. Kinetic Fluidity refers to the rate at which a textile drapes and recovers during movement under humidity without collapsing against the skin. Silk-rayon blends capture and reflect ambient golden-hour light more subtly than pure synthetics, preventing harsh reflective glare on camera.
Double-Gauze Muslin Micro-Climates utilize two ultralight layers of open-weave cotton bound together by invisible anchor stitches. This construction traps an insulating pocket of air that balances body temperature during sudden coastal breeze shifts.
Compact Cotton Poplin Weights between 100 and 120 GSM deliver the crisp, clean lines required for artistic statement shirts. It provides enough surface stability for complex graphic registration while remaining featherlight on the body.

High-twist spinning applies extra rotations per inch to individual yarn strands during production. This torsion compacts the fiber core and creates microscopic spring tension throughout the thread.
When woven into an open structure, high-twist yarns resist surface abrasion and create tiny air gaps between adjacent threads. The human eye perceives this as a crisp, dimensional surface texture that drapes cleanly without clinging to damp skin.

Silk-rayon blends combine the soft luster of silk with the moisture-wicking and durable structure of rayon. Pure silk weakens when wet and develops permanent water spots from perspiration, whereas silk-rayon blends handle ambient moisture and wash cycles far more effectively.
Pinch the fabric firmly for three seconds and release it immediately. Standard low-twist linen retains sharp, deep crease lines, while high-twist linen springs back slightly and softens its folds under the natural warmth of your fingers.
